Bob
6429f168e1
Layout updates
...
rediscovered my old keysets file, adapted the functionality to make a flexible base layout tool.
also tweaked double sculpting to generically sculpt to both hands. it works, but it still needs more refinement, and the best layouts are going to be hand-generated anyways
2019-12-16 16:45:03 -05:00
Bob
7a8302fe55
Add double-sculpting
2019-12-16 00:40:43 -05:00
Robert Sheldon
1fe1a23f29
small fixes
...
SMALLEST_POSSIBLE fixes originating from talks in the openSCAD repo about float rounding issues w/r/t STL. couple more I don't remember 😕
2019-09-06 22:12:49 -04:00
Robert Sheldon
1149cade39
various small fixes while preparing for release
2018-07-26 01:48:20 -04:00
Robert Sheldon
bbcb44feca
remove boilerplate
2018-07-04 21:49:02 -04:00
Robert Sheldon
dc9b2a5aa6
remove models directory and switch to generating them via script
2018-07-04 21:12:07 -04:00
Robert Sheldon
bb3b8525d4
switch to intersection instead of difference for dishing. faster and better. uses a clipping envelope around the key
2018-06-30 22:37:24 -04:00
Bob - Home - Windows
be15a0d988
small detour. break out stem support into its own folder as there are two types now. also add box_cherry option for box cherry stems
2018-06-30 20:14:49 -04:00
Robert Sheldon
ff77b6492c
add customizer_base. move settings variables to make more sense, in customizer and outside of it. switch (back?) to using rounded_cherry instead of cherry_rounded
2018-06-27 01:12:43 -04:00
Robert Sheldon
410f25c88e
break out stabilizers from stems
2018-06-25 00:41:02 -04:00
Robert Sheldon
50ad7c73ed
promote sculpted, rounded squares into their own shape
2018-06-24 17:13:51 -04:00
Robert Sheldon
2adc646911
multi legend tweaks. also begin moving homing bump into its own directory
2018-06-03 20:12:51 -04:00
Myles Metzler
ad86c1a7a9
Move legend from key function to legend function.
...
legend function may be called repeatedly, with posititioning and sizing parameters to place multiple legends on a key.
2018-02-25 00:21:42 -05:00
Bob - Home - Windows
dd6574137f
mergin on up
2018-02-12 21:40:48 -05:00
Bob - Home - Windows
911543bea4
add newly generated base models
2018-02-12 21:36:36 -05:00
Bob - Home - Windows
48883bd8b1
add customizer script, fix height bug
2018-02-06 01:26:19 -05:00
Bob - Home - Windows
aa795c4958
make this library a lot more modular
2018-02-04 15:43:17 -05:00
Bob - Home - Windows
2368961370
a whole bunch of work
2018-02-04 14:33:12 -05:00
Bob - Home - Windows
a537407cca
make shapes much more powerful by passing them a progress prop and starting width / height with width / height end delta
2018-01-30 12:01:38 -05:00
Bob - Home - Windows
b4301c097f
add more info to readme, like examples. hopefully including pictures via github directly
2017-12-29 00:41:31 -05:00
Bob - Home - Windows
6d2bb24ccb
add a massive chunk of stuff because you forgot to keep doing atomic commits
2017-12-20 00:47:03 -05:00
Bob - Home - Windows
f252ec2c30
try to get some numbers closer for the iso enter
2017-12-10 15:53:44 -05:00
Bob - Home - Windows
ded7af69da
add dish overdraw to solve incorrect dishing on ISO Enter key due to repositioning the shape to always be centered
2017-12-05 20:48:11 -05:00
Bob - Home - Windows
736f3a6d70
pushing up to continue work elsewhere. actually abstracting ISO shape
2017-11-18 16:44:35 -05:00
Bob - Home - Windows
65d6656056
adding supports, switching util to shape, and trying to abstract ISO enter shape
2017-11-12 13:01:17 -05:00
Bob - Home - Windows
5f60c1889b
some ISO enter updates
2017-11-11 17:32:27 -05:00
Bob - Home - Windows
dcc13b7d35
switch rounded_shape to use half minkowski sum for height and promote connector slop to full special variable
2017-11-05 17:56:05 -05:00
Bob - Home - Windows
e23dae799b
merging on up
2017-10-24 23:30:18 -04:00
Bob - Home - Windows
771e4f8c0e
rounded cherry keystem and tweaked numbers. also nice color scheme
2017-10-24 22:56:35 -04:00
Robert Sheldon
83f5d0cd80
remove confusing zip file
2017-10-24 12:57:42 -04:00
Bob - Home - Windows
16f97911ae
finalize keysets.scad (just 60%, the other profiles will take too much work for negligent gain since who prints an 86 key keyset out in one go) and add top_of_key to allow for children of key() to be rendered smack in the middle of the keytop
2017-10-17 00:51:07 -04:00
Robert Sheldon
d9747e76b5
add inset() function to allow for stem inset specification
2017-09-28 12:39:11 -04:00
Bob - Home - Windows
09ce679f05
stem updates; flared top of stem for better support, investigating connecting stem halves
2017-09-27 00:16:08 -04:00
Bob - Home - Windows
005a520a82
actually merge though
2017-09-25 00:47:26 -04:00
Bob - Home - Windows
1d2187223c
Merge branch 'sa-rounding' of https://github.com/rsheldiii/openSCAD-projects into sa-rounding
2017-09-25 00:07:48 -04:00
Bob - Home - Windows
72173cffc8
cleanup, fix inverted dishes with sculpted sides, add oem key profile
2017-09-25 00:04:34 -04:00
Bob - Home - Windows
7e9e2f0e1e
move brim to stems.scad so cherry keys can cut out their cross. makes it way easier to print
2017-08-19 12:06:13 -04:00
Robert Sheldon
a6db17d78b
prelim work on polyhedron generated dishes. its uh... its gonna be a challenge
2017-08-17 09:57:56 -04:00
Bob - Home - Windows
397c57ca97
small tweaks
2017-08-17 02:09:17 -04:00
Bob - Home - Windows
b879c854ed
got SA sculpting into variable, futzing with keysets sort of
2017-08-16 01:59:19 -04:00
Robert Sheldon
5edb404697
lol ISO enter on the SA branch #madlads
2017-08-15 23:56:27 -04:00
Bob - Home - Windows
f0d1220c63
looks great, but now other profiles rounding is off. need to add option for progressive side rounding
2017-08-15 01:59:12 -04:00
Bob - Home - Windows
0333f1718d
SA rounding experimentation with segmented height and better dishes
2017-08-14 22:48:01 -04:00
Robert Sheldon
f9d9197a84
add utility functions for rounded keycaps and flesh out some comments
2017-08-13 12:15:42 -04:00
Bob - Home - Windows
43e20beaaa
should really have a changelog huh
2017-08-13 03:04:53 -04:00
Bob - Home - Windows
44da611cdd
key V2 with modular design and nestable attributes
2017-08-12 01:11:15 -04:00